Current Status of Bill S 1625
Bill S 1625 is currently in the status of Bill Introduced since May 13, 2021. Bill S 1625 was introduced during Congress 117 and was introduced to the Senate on May 13, 2021. Bill S 1625's most recent activity was Read twice and referred to the Committee on the Judiciary. as of May 13, 2021
